The Importance of Security and Regulation
In the digital realm, security is paramount. A reputable online casino will employ state-of-the-art encryption technology to protect player data and financial transactions. Look for platforms that utilize SSL (Secure Socket Layer) encryption, indicated by a padlock icon in the browser's address bar. Beyond encryption, robust security measures include fir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and regular security audits. These proactive steps minimize the risk of cyber threats and ensure a safe gaming environment. Players should also be wary of phishing scams and always verify the legitimacy of any communication claiming to be from the casino.
Furthermore, regulation by a recognized authority is a crucial indicator of trustworthiness. Licensing bodies such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Curacao eGaming provide oversight and ensure that the casino operates in compliance with strict standards. These standards cover areas such as fairness, responsible gambling, and anti-money laundering measures. A valid license demonstrates that the casino has undergone rigorous scrutiny and is committed to upholding a high level of integrity. Players can typically find information about a casino’s licensing credentials on its website, usually in the footer section. Always verify the license’s validity on the licensing authority’s official website.

Navigating Bonuses and Promotions
Online casinos frequently entice new players with bonuses and promotions, and these can be a valuable way to boost your bankroll. However, it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with these offers.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which specify the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. Other important factors to consider include game restrictions (certain games may not contribute to the wagering requirement) and maximum bet limits. Failing to meet these conditions can result in forfeited bonus funds and winnings.
Beyond welcome bonuses, many casinos offer ongoing promotions such as reload b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. Reload bonuses provide a percentage match on subsequent deposits, while free spins allow you to play slot games without using your own funds. Loyalty programs reward players for their continued patronage, often offering exclusive bonuses, personalized offers, and faster withdrawal times. Always read the fine print carefully and compare offers from different casinos to find the most advantageous terms. Don’t be swayed solely by the size of the bonus; consider the wagering requirements and other conditions to ensure a fair and rewarding experience.
